Product Introduction

Bioactivity
Description
GABAA receptor agent 7 (compound 5c) is a potent positive modulator of the GABAA receptor with anticonvulsant activity in vitro and in vivo, and low neurotoxicity, making it suitable for epilepsy research [1].
In vitro
GABAA receptor agent 7 (compound 5c) exhibits anticonvulsant properties, demonstrating an inhibitory concentration (IC50) of 0.452 μM in the 4-AP induced hyper-excitability model [1]. Additionally, it enhances GABA-induced activation of the GABAA1 receptor dose-dependently within a concentration range of 0.01-100 μM over a period of 0-140 seconds, with an effective concentration (EC50) of 3.08 μM [1].
In vivo
GABAA receptor agent 7 demonstrates anticonvulsant properties in mice, achieving an effective dose 50 (ED50) of 31.81 mg/kg and a toxic dose 50 (TD50) of 547.89 mg/kg [1]. This compound specifically mitigates seizures induced by pentylenetetrazol (PTZ) without affecting those caused by maximal electroshock (MES) in mice [1].
Chemical Properties
Molecular Weight336.77
FormulaC18H13ClN4O
Cas No.2376841-18-6
Storage & Solubility Information
StoragePowder: -20°C for 3 years | In solvent: -80°C for 1 year
